About this role

We are seeking a highly skilled Data Engineer with a passion for industrial data and analytics. This role focuses on developing robust data pipelines and analytics solutions for time-series data generated from heating, refrigeration, and process equipment. You will play a key role in transforming raw industrial data into actionable insights, supporting digital product development and operational excellence. Responsibilities / Tasks Design, build, and maintain scalable data pipelines (batch & streaming) with a focus on time-series data from heating, refrigeration, and process equipment Develop and operationalize advanced analytics workflows by integrating data from multiple industrial and enterprise sources Work closely with Data Analysts and Digital Product teams to enable data-driven product features and insights Contribute to and enhance the GEA Cloud Analytics Platform in collaboration with the Digital Hub Ensure high data quality, reliability, and performance across pipelines and platforms Apply modern software engineering practices (version control, CI/CD, code reviews) Actively participate in the Data Engineering / Data Science Guild to drive knowledge sharing and standardization Build reusable, modular, and efficient data solutions using state-of-the-art tools Your Profile / Qualifications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ics , or a related field 2–5 years of experience in Data Engineering or related roles Strong experience in building robust and scalable data pipelines Hands-on experience with Spark / Databricks or similar big data frameworks Strong programming skills in Python and SQL Experience handling time-series data, industrial IoT, or real-time analytics (highly preferred) Understanding of data modeling, ETL/ELT processes, and data architecture Familiarity with Agile methodologies and collaborative development Strong communication skills with fluency in English Did we spark your interest?
